The right heart is responsible for _________________ circulation. - Correct answer
|| || || || || || || || || || ||
✔pulmonary circulation. Pumps blood through the lungs.
|| || || || || ||
The left heart is responsible for _________________ circulation. - Correct answer
|| || || || || || || || || || ||
✔systemic circulation. pumps blood through the body.
|| || || || || ||
Blood travels from the lungs to the left atrium through the: - Correct answer
|| || || || || || || || || || || || || ||
✔pulmonary veins with oxygenated blood. || || || ||
Which ventricle is larger and why? - Correct answer ✔the left ventricle is much larger
|| || || || || || || || || || || || || || ||
than the right and creates a much higher pressure to drive the movement of
|| || || || || || || || || || || || || ||
oxygenated blood throughout the body. || || || ||
Where is the highest pressure in the cardiac circuit?
|| || || || || || || ||
lowest? - Correct answer ✔highest = left ventricle.
|| || || || || || ||
lowest = right atrium.
|| || ||
The space between the lungs that contains the heart, major vessels and esophagus. -
|| || || || || || || || || || || || || ||
Correct answer ✔mediastinum.

What are the three layers of the heart? - Correct answer ✔1. epicardium - outer layer,
|| || || || || || || || || || || || || || || ||
visceral layer of the pericardium.
|| || || ||
2. myocardium - composed of cardiac muscle, the myocytes allows for contractions.
|| || || || || || || || || || ||
3. endocardium - inner lining, endothelial layer that lines the lumen.
|| || || || || || || || || ||
What does the endocardium allow for? - Correct answer ✔allows for efficient flow of
|| || || || || || || || || || || || || ||
blood through the heart and able to respond to changes in signal.
|| || || || || || || || || || || ||
Also allows for increased membrane permeability when needed.
|| || || || || || ||
infection of the pericardium is:
|| || || ||
Sx? - Correct answer ✔pericarditis.
|| || || ||
pain, increased friction, discomfort.
|| || ||
Three components of the pericardium: - Correct answer ✔1. pericardial sac.
|| || || || || || || || || ||
2. pericardial cavity.
|| ||
3. pericardial fluid.
|| ||
Where is the pericardial fluid located?
|| || || || ||

function? - Correct answer ✔this fluid is between the visceral (epicardium) and parietal
|| || || || || || || || || || || || ||
pericardium.
it helps to decrease friction and damage.
|| || || || || ||
What does an increase in pericardial fluid cause?
|| || || || || || ||
What is the typical cause of this? - Correct answer ✔prevents adequate blood flow
|| || || || || || || || || || || || || ||
through the heart. Does not allow for adequate contractions of the heart.
|| || || || || || || || || || || ||
usually occurs d/t bleeding in the pericardium -- can be life threatening if occurs
|| || || || || || || || || || || || || ||
suddenly.
What is trabeculae carneae? - Correct answer ✔muscle struts that help give structure
|| || || || || || || || || || || || ||
and support to the myocardium.
|| || || || ||
Papillary muscles arise from these to give support to the AV valves.
|| || || || || || || || || || ||
Where is the tricuspid valve located?
|| || || || ||
number of cusps/flaps? - Correct answer ✔between the right atria and right ventricle.
|| || || || || || || || || || || ||
This is an AV valve.
|| || || || ||
3.
Where is the mitral valve located?
|| || || || ||

number of cusps/flaps? - Correct answer ✔between the left atria and left ventricle. This
|| || || || || || || || || || || || || ||
is the other AV valve.
|| || || ||
Looks like a bishops hat. 2 cusps/flaps.
|| || || || || ||
Where are the semilunar valves located?
|| || || || ||
name them. - Correct answer ✔between the ventricles and the major arteries.
|| || || || || || || || || || ||
1. pulmonary semilunar valve - b/t right ventricle and pulmonary artery.
|| || || || || || || || || ||
2. aortic semilunar valve - b/t left ventricle and aorta.
|| || || || || || || || || ||
these can be prolapsed or stenosed, but typically not as likely as AV valves.
|| || || || || || || || || || || || ||
Which types of valves have chordae tendineae?
|| || || || || ||
function? - Correct answer ✔The AV valves.
|| || || || || ||
These are attached to papillary muscles and support the valves. As the valve closes, the
|| || || || || || || || || || || || || || ||
muscle contracts to support the valve and flaps to prevent blood from being pushed
|| || || || || || || || || || || || || ||
back into the atrium. (like an umbrella).
|| || || || || ||
What happens if there is damage to the chordae tendineae? - Correct answer ✔prolapse
|| || || || || || || || || || || || ||
valve. Blood will begin to regurgitate.
|| || || || || ||
